What is Tile Roofing?
Tile roofing dates back to the B.C.E era when clay tiles were employed for rooftops in Ancient China. Later on, the technique was enhanced throughout the Arabian Peninsula and other countries in the Middle East.
Roof tiles can be made of many materials, including mud bricks, natural stone, earthenware, and basalt. Thanks to technical advancements, tile roofing can now be made from various materials, including metal, colored asphalt, bituminous, and thermoplastic sand.
A tile roofing installation is a unique roof installation that requires specialized knowledge and significant experience. Commencing at the roof’s foundation, connect a series of panels to the top deck, then lay the next set of tiles over the previous until the roof is entirely covered.
Types Of Tile Roofing
1. Galvanized Tiles
Galvanized, often referred to as Galvalume, is an affordable and durable roofing solution for coastal homes. It can last over 60 years if properly installed and maintained. It comes in many styles and colors and is generally made out of alloyed steel featuring a zinc coat for additional protection. This material is resistant to rain, heavy winds, and rusting. To ensure that it works well for long, try to reapply the zinc coat every 20 years.
2. Slate Tiles
Slate tiles are highly durable and can last for 50 to 100 years. They are highly distinctive and aesthetically appealing. If you’re seeking a French or Colonial feel, you should surely go for this type.
3. Concrete Tiles
Concrete tiles are popular in climates with hot weather and low rainfall. They are made from concrete and come in various colors and styles. Concrete tiles are also relatively affordable and can last for up to 50 years. However, they are not as durable as metal roofs and can be damaged by high winds or hail.
Advantages Of Tile Roofing
1. They Are Fire-Resistant
Roofs made of tile are incombustible. Terracotta and ceramic tiles offer the most fire resistance, making them the best choice for bushfire-prone locations. This makes them a popular choice among most homeowners.
2. They Have Soundproofing Effect
Roofing tiles have incredible soundproofing properties. It successfully blocks and decreases noise from accessing your home or workplace, letting you sleep soundly without being disturbed.
When compared to other roof shingles, tile can dampen vibrations. It prevents disturbance from your property if you reside in a noisy community. During bad thunderstorms, this would not conflict with your nightly siesta, helping you sleep soundly at home.
